Three pipes \(A, B,\) and \(C\) can fill tank in \(10, 15\) and \(25\) minutes respectively. All the three taps are used simultaneously to fill the tank. But, due to a leak at the bottom of the tank, only \(\dfrac{1}{3}\)rd of the tank was filled by the time it was supposed to be full. In how much time could the leak empty a full tank?
A. \(\dfrac{75}{31}\)
B. \(\dfrac{150}{31}\)
C. \(\dfrac{225}{31}\)
D. \(\dfrac{15}{2}\)
E. \(\dfrac{450}{31}\)
The OA is C
